I have a cracked spring (common fault I know) so am using this as an opportunity to improve the stock suspension.
Option 1)
Eibach ProSystem suspension kit
around 500 EUR on Alfisti
Option 2)
Eibach-Bilstein Suspension Kit "Sportiva" (B6 Sport Shocks & ProKit Springs also known as the B12 Pro Kit I beleive)
around 649 EUR on Alfisti
Option 3)
As per Option 2 but with Eibach Sportline Springs.
50mm drop & harder ride.
around the same price as option 2
I don't want to step up into the coilover brackit as the cost jump is too much to swallow right now, and I have had feedback that it can be too harsh for a daily driver.
My requirements are:
- It needs to feel firmer than the stock TI setup but not be a bone breaker
- It needs to be not much lower than the TI is right now on 19's as clearance is useful!
- I can do upwards of 1000 miles in a week sometimes and I dont want to get to my cleints looking like I have just run the nurburg.
Simple really.
Ideas?
